Position Description
Receives, stores, and distributes products within establishment by performing the following duties. This work is done under moderate to strong supervision.
Responsibilities
- Reads order to determine items to be moved, gathered and distributed.
- Assist in training of trainees and temporaries on how to perform all their duties safely.
- Performs operator maintenance as necessary.
- Prepare and match appropriate records and/or documents.
- Assists in accounting for all materials received accurately with proper documentation (packing slips, return authorizations, MSDS)
- Assist/perform the duty of filling outbound shipments accurately again with proper documentation (stenciling, staging).
- Maintain upkeep on warehouse equipment.
- Conveys material and items from receiving or production areas to storage or to other designated areas.
- Sorts and places materials or items on racks, shelves, or in bins according to predetermined sequence such as size or product code.
- Marks products with identifying information.
- Backfills for Warehouse Lead (s) responsible for the overall direction, coordination, staffing and evaluation of the shipping warehouse department, working closely with the Shipping Coordinator as well as other work functions. Other duties could include cycle counting, computer entry of records, coordination of dispositions, and assisting in coordination of yearly physical inventory.
